Product information

Description

  • 1900 Watt
  • No load speed: 11500rpm
  • Paddle switch
  • Cardboard box

Whether used to grind concrete or cut metal, grinders are incredibly versatile power tools. You can choose between angle grinders, straight die grinders and cut-off saws which, depending on the task, may be electric, pneumatic or fuel-powered. Makita manufactures its tools in plants across the globe, from its headquarters in Japan to here, in the UK. Our Telford manufacturing plant is the only full-production facility for power tools in the UK and has been successfully running construction on many of our top line cordless power tools since 1991.
